Abstract

This study aims to analysis the relationship between principal leadership, organizational climate, competency and motivation toward teacher performance and students’ competency. For the study, the verification survey research method was used, in the unit of analysis of vocational teachers in Business and Management Expertise in Bandung. The data analysis technique used is path analysis. The results showed that there was a positive and significant contribution of principals’ leadership, organizational climate, competence, and work motivation to teacher performance, both partially and simultaneously. Therefore, the conclusions of the study are the high or low teacher performance determined by the effectiveness of the leadership of the principal, the conduciveness of the school organizational climate, the high and low teacher competencies, and the high and low motivation of the teacher’s work.
